16 references to MemberAccess
Microsoft.CodeAnalysis.VisualBasic (16)
Analysis\FlowAnalysis\AbstractFlowPass.vb (1)
2608VisitRvalue(node.MemberAccess)
Binding\Binder_Expressions.vb (2)
1358Dim enclosed = MakeRValue(memberAccess.MemberAccess, diagnostics) 1767Return IsValidAssignmentTarget(DirectCast(expression, BoundXmlMemberAccess).MemberAccess)
Binding\Binder_Statements.vb (1)
1929Dim expr = AdjustAssignmentTarget(node, memberAccess.MemberAccess, diagnostics, isError)
BoundTree\BoundExpressionExtensions.vb (5)
120Return DirectCast(node, BoundXmlMemberAccess).MemberAccess.IsPropertyOrXmlPropertyAccess() 164Return DirectCast(node, BoundXmlMemberAccess).MemberAccess.GetPropertyOrXmlProperty() 182Return DirectCast(node, BoundXmlMemberAccess).MemberAccess.IsPropertySupportingAssignment() 248Return DirectCast(node, BoundXmlMemberAccess).MemberAccess.GetAccessKind() 313Dim expr = node.MemberAccess.SetAccessKind(newAccessKind)
Generated\BoundNodes.xml.Generated.vb (4)
8241If memberAccess IsNot Me.MemberAccess OrElse type IsNot Me.Type Then 11923Me.Visit(node.MemberAccess) 12997Dim memberAccess As BoundExpression = DirectCast(Me.Visit(node.MemberAccess), BoundExpression) 14428New TreeDumperNode("memberAccess", Nothing, new TreeDumperNode() {Visit(node.MemberAccess, Nothing)}),
Lowering\LocalRewriter\LocalRewriter_AssignmentOperator.vb (1)
177Return RewritePropertyAssignmentAsSetCall(node, DirectCast(setNode, BoundXmlMemberAccess).MemberAccess)
Lowering\LocalRewriter\LocalRewriter_XmlLiterals.vb (1)
66Return Visit(node.MemberAccess)
Lowering\UseTwiceRewriter.vb (1)
50Dim result = UseTwice(containingMember, memberAccess.MemberAccess, isForRegularCompoundAssignment, temporaries)